DAC081S101CIMMX/NOPB Description

Short technical summary and product information.

The DAC081S101CIMMX/NOPB from Texas Instruments is a full-featured, general-purpose 8-bit voltage-output digital-to-analog converter (DAC). It is designed for low power consumption and operates from a single supply voltage ranging from +2.7V to +5.5V.

 

Key electrical specifications include an 8-bit resolution, a single DAC channel, and a buffered voltage output. The device supports SPI and DSP interfaces, with a supply voltage that also serves as its voltage reference, enabling the widest possible output dynamic range. It has an integral non-linearity (INL) of +0.16/-0.12, +0.04/-0.02 LSB and a settling time of 5µs.

 

This DAC operates within a temperature range of -40°C to 105°C. It is available in an 8-VSSOP package, with the case being 8-TSSOP, 8-MSOP (0.118", 3.00mm Width). The mounting type is surface mount.

 

A power-on reset circuit ensures the DAC output powers up to zero volts until a valid write occurs. A power-down feature is also included to reduce power consumption. The device boasts a sample/update rate of 1.8 Msps and a typical power consumption of 0.63 mW.
